28th Defence Review Meeting Held in Quetta to Review Overall Law and Order and Security Situation in Balochistan
Quetta (By Syed Sardar Mohammad Khondai)
The 28th Defence Review Meeting was held in Quetta to review the overall law and order and security situation in Balochistan.
The meeting was jointly chaired by Chief Minister Balochistan Mir Sarfraz Bugti and Corps Commander Quetta. The forum conducted a detailed review of peace and stability in the province, security measures, and the status of ongoing development projects.
In a major and principled decision, the meeting approved the phased activation of the Safe City Project in Quetta and other important districts and cities of the province, which will significantly improve crime prevention and protection of citizens.
Addressing the meeting, Chief Minister Mir Sarfraz Bugti said that these regularly held meetings are yielding highly positive and far-reaching results. He said that by holding this meeting every three weeks, implementation of previous decisions is ensured and the law and order situation is reviewed with continuity.
The meeting was attended by senior representatives of civil and military institutions, intelligence agencies and security forces. The participants appreciated the performance of the security forces for successful Intelligence-Based Operations (IBOs) against terrorism and crime in recent days and paid tribute to them.
In the end, all participants reaffirmed their resolve that all resources will be utilized for a bright future for Balochistan, sustainable peace, timely completion of development projects and the welfare of the people.
